linux面试用到的命令

fiy 其他 2

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ux面试中,可能会涉及到多个命令,以下列举了一些常见的Linux命令,供您参考:

    1. ls:列出目录内容。常用选项有-l(长格式显示)、-a(显示所有文件,包括隐藏文件)等。

    2. cd:切换目录。用法是cd [目录路径],不带参数则切换到当前用户的主目录。

    3. pwd:显示当前所在的目录。

    4. touch:创建新文件。可以用touch [文件名]命令创建新的空文件。

    5. rm:删除文件或目录。常用选项有-rf(强制删除目录及其文件)等。

    6. cp:复制文件或目录。用法是cp [源文件路径] [目标文件路径]。

    7. mv:移动文件或目录。用法与cp类似,但mv会将源文件移动到目标位置,而不是复制。

    8. cat:查看文件内容。常用于查看文本文件。

    9. less/more:分页方式查看文件内容。适用于大文件。

    10. grep:在文件中搜索指定的字符串。常用选项有-i(忽略大小写)、-r(递归搜索)等。

    11. find:根据条件搜索文件。用法是find [路径] [条件]。

    12. tar:打包和解压文件。常用选项有-c(打包)、-x(解压)、-v(显示详细信息)等。

    13. chmod:修改文件或目录的权限。用法是chmod [权限] [文件或目录]。

    14. chown:修改文件或目录的所有者。用法是chown [所有者] [文件或目录]。

    15. ps:查看进程状态。常用选项有-a(显示所有进程)、-u(以用户格式显示进程信息)等。

    16. top:实时监控系统进程的资源占用情况。

    17. ifconfig:查看和配置网络接口信息。

    18. netstat:查看网络连接状态和路由表信息。

    19. ssh:远程登录其他Linux主机。

    20. scp:在本地和远程主机之间复制文件。

    以上仅为一些常见的Linux命令,具体面试中会涉及到的命令还可能根据岗位需求而有所不同。在面试前,建议您对这些命令进行充分的学习和练习,以便能够熟练地操作。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ux面试过程中,可能会涉及到许多常用的命令。以下是一些常见的Linux面试中可能会用到的命令。

    1. ls:用于列出目录中的文件和文件夹。可以使用不同的选项来显示详细信息,例如文件的大小、权限和时间戳。

    2. cd:用于改变当前工作目录。可以使用相对路径或绝对路径来导航到其他目录。

    3. pwd:用于显示当前工作目录的路径。

    4. cp:用于复制文件或目录。可以指定源文件或目录的路径,以及目标文件或目录的路径。

    5. mv:用于移动文件或目录,也可以用于更改文件或目录的名称。可以指定源文件或目录的路径,以及目标文件或目录的路径。

    6. rm:用于删除文件或目录。可以指定要删除的文件或目录的路径。请小心,此命令不能撤销。

    7. mkdir:用于创建新目录。可以指定要创建的目录的名称,在需要的情况下可以指定路径。

    8. rmdir:用于删除空目录。该命令将只删除空目录,如果目录中存在文件或子目录,则会失败。

    9. cat:用于查看文件的内容,也可以用于将多个文件连接起来并输出到标准输出流。

    10. grep:用于在文件中搜索指定的模式,例如特定的字符串。可以使用不同的选项来控制搜索的方式。

    11. find:用于在指定目录及其子目录中搜索文件。可以使用不同的选项来筛选搜索结果,例如按文件类型、大小或修改日期进行过滤。

    12. chmod:用于更改文件或目录的权限。可以使用不同的选项来分别设置文件所有者、群组和其他用户的权限。

    13. chown:用于更改文件或目录的所有者。可以指定新的所有者用户和群组。

    14. top:用于查看系统的实时运行状态和进程信息。它会显示正在运行的进程的列表,并根据CPU和内存使用情况进行排序。

    15. ps:用于查看系统中运行的进程。可以使用不同的选项来获取更详细的信息,例如进程的ID、父进程ID和状态。

    16. kill:用于终止运行中的进程。可以使用不同的信号来指定终止的方式,例如SIGTERM或SIGKILL。

    17. tar:用于打包和解压文件。可以将多个文件和目录打包成一个文件,也可以解压已经压缩的文件。

    18. ssh:用于与远程服务器建立安全的shell会话。可以使用不同的选项来指定远程主机的用户名、端口等。

    19. scp:用于在本地主机和远程服务器之间进行文件传输。可以使用不同的选项来指定传输的方向、用户名、端口等。

    20. ping:用于测试与目标主机的连接。可以使用目标主机的IP地址或域名作为参数。

    以上是一些常见的Linux面试中可能会用到的命令。掌握这些命令可以展示你对Linux系统的熟练度和操作能力。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ux面试中,常常会涉及到对命令行的操作和管理。下面是一些常见的Linux命令,可以在面试中用到:

    1. ls命令:用于列出当前目录中的文件和子目录。

    2. cd命令:用于切换目录。

    3. mkdir命令:用于创建目录。

    4. rm命令:用于删除文件或目录。

    5. cp命令:用于复制文件或目录。

    6. mv命令:用于移动文件或目录,也可以用于重命名文件。

    7. vi或vim命令:用于编辑文本文件。

    8. cat命令:用于查看文件内容。

    9. grep命令:用于在文件中查找指定的字符串。

    10. awk命令:用于处理文本文件,可以进行数据提取和格式化。

    11. sed命令:用于对文本进行替换和编辑。

    12. ps命令:用于查看当前系统的进程状态。

    13. top命令:用于实时监控系统的进程和资源占用情况。

    14. df命令:用于查看磁盘空间使用情况。

    15. du命令:用于查看目录或文件的大小。

    16. tar命令:用于打包和压缩文件和目录。

    17. ssh命令:用于远程登录到其他Linux服务器。

    18. scp命令:用于在本地计算机和远程计算机之间复制文件。

    19. chown命令:用于修改文件或目录的所有者。

    20. chmod命令:用于修改文件或目录的权限。

    这些是面试中常见的Linux命令,掌握好这些命令,可以帮助你更好地完成面试中的问题。当然,在实际操作中,还有很多其他的命令和工具可以用到,不同的工作岗位和需求会有不同的命令要求。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部